How to Experience AYSF Training in Christ-Centered Care

AYSF Training: for Individuals
If you are an individual interested in AYSF Training in Christ-Centered Care, we invite you to join our next AYSF-hosted cohort. You will learn (live, online) with a select group of Christians from around the country (may be all women or co-ed). The program is designed in two phases. In Phase 1: Foundations for Christ-Centered Care, the cohort meets over the course of 9 months for weekly training, bi-weekly practice sessions with fellow cohort members, and a monthly one-on-one with your AYSF instructor. Those in the cohort who desire hands-on practice with in-depth feedback will move on to the 8 week practicum in Phase 2, in which you will have the opportunity to participate in live sessions with a woman seeking Christ-Centered Care.
